Make it @ the MILL Lithophanes

Transform your favorite photos into a stunning 3D-printed lithophane! You'll learn the step-by-step process of converting an image into a 3D model using free software.

A lithophane is a unique piece of art where an image is carved or molded into a semi-translucent material. When a light source is placed behind it, the image magically appears!

Please bring your own laptop to participate, as you will be modeling your own lithophane. No prior experience with 3D modeling is necessary. We will provide instructions on what software to download beforehand.
